Minutes

Participants: Curtis, Naomi (CMU), Sean (NU), Beni, Luke, Chris, Nick, Bill, Fernando, and Lubomir (JLab).

DAQ

- Beni: testing the latest fADC125 firmware in ROCFDC2. This version has some fixes that Cody did based on the problems Beni found last week. For these tests needs DAQ with software trigger. ROCFDC3 has problems: works at the beginning but later has no valid data.

- Lubomir: according to Sasha he made a big progress with the GTP using BCAL north side. There are some minor issues but expect soon to have the BCAL up/down coincidence trigger. When it's ready we have to move the CDC/FDC trigger electronics from the bottom to the top trigger crate. The fan on the bottom trigger crate was replaced and there are no more spare fans; not clear what the problem is with these fan units.

CDC update

- Fernado: working with Nick on the CDC noise from the CAEN supply. Contacted CAEN people: they are trying to be helpful. Grounding of the aluminum ring didn't help. They found two HVBs next to each other, one (C5) is very clean while the other (C6) has huge noise varying from channel to channel. Will use them to troubleshoot the noise.
